WAEC Official Confirms Buhari’s Result

A senior official of the West African Examination Council (WAEC) has confirmed the authenticity of the copy of the University of Cambridge school certificate tendered by President Buhari on Tuesday.

This happened when the official, Oshindeinde Henry Adewunmi appeared on Wednesday before the Presidential Election Petition Tribunal as a witness for President Muhammadu Buhari.

Naija News recalls President Buhari had on Tuesday opened his defence in the case instituted by Atiku Abubakar and the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) challenging Buhari’s 2019 presidential election victory.

As part of their claims, Atiku and PDP are maintaining that Buhari did not have the secondary school certificate which should qualify him to contest for the office of the president in Nigeria.

Buhari called Adewunmi as his first witness for the second day of his defence before the election tribunal.

Adewunmi identified himself as the Deputy Registrar in Charge of School Examination in Nigeria.

He said he has been with WAEC for 30 years, and confirmed that by the result, Buhari sat for eight subjects and obtained five credits.

He listed the subjects as English C5, History C3, Geography C6, Hausa C5, Health Science C6, noting that a person with such a certificate cannot be said not to have attended secondary school.
